mmc: zynq_sdhci: Split set_tapdelay function to in and out

Split arasan_zynqmp_set_tapdelay() to handle input and output tapdelays
separately. This is required to handle zero values for ITAP and OTAP
values. If we dont split, we will have to remove the if() in the
function, which makes ITAP values to be overwritten when OTAP values are
called to set and vice-versa.

Restrict tap_delay value calculated to max allowed 8 bits for ITAP and 6
bits for OTAP for ZynqMP.
